How Reliable is the Isuzu Tf?

Based on 43,907 MOT tests across 3,289 vehicles.

70.6%
Pass Rate
7,037
Miles/Year
27
Year Lifespan
3,289
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Shock absorber has an excessively worn bush 1,460
Brake pipe excessively corroded 1,211
Leaf spring has excessive wear in a shackle pin and/or bush 1,004
fog lamp not working 960
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 787

C23 TAW is a 2012 Isuzu Tf in Black with a 2,499c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.

Across all 2012 Isuzu Tf models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.9% with a typical mileage of 75,235 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Isuzu Tf fails its MOT is shock absorber has an excessively worn bush, accounting for 1,460 recorded failures. If you're considering buying C23 TAW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Isuzu Tf typ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 14 years old, this Isuzu Tf is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
